Going around Bookstores in Ikebukuro, Tokyo

Going further to Ikebukuro through the Saikyo line or the Nakasendo Road, R17, or the Kawagoe Kaido Road, R254. Ikebukuro is convenient place as there are large booksellers in line.

At first, let's go to the Ikebukuro Branch of Junkudo Shoten which was made a few years ago. Junkudo got famous because it forced into Ikebukuro where are many booksellers and it introduced sit-down reading in a bookseller into Tokyo on a large scale. I think it keeps the best selection in Ikebukuro. The particular and a little crazy bookshelves in Junkudo keep interesting us. There are books that may be in public libraries and may not be in usual booksellers. I sometimes arrange to meet in Junkudo, because it has a cafe. After the recent complete refurbishment, they talk big on their website that "The floor area is the largest in the world! Everyday stock is one and a half million books!". (2001.3.14)

There is "Libro" the book building of the Ikebukuro Branch of the Seibu Department Stores across the street. It moved around in the department store, it settles in the building where was the Seibu Museum of Art. There used to be a particular arrangement called "the bookshelf of Seibu"....

There is Tobu Department Store on the right after passing under a railroad over the entrance of the book building of Seibu. The Ikebukuro Branch of Asahiya Shoten is in Tobu. It looks a bookseller in a department store or an ordinary large scale bookseller. It kept once many books written by Honda Shin'ichi, however, the person in charge of the bookshelf may be changed, it now keep few.

Going toward Marui Store from Tobu Department Store, there is the main store of Horindo Shoten. It sells sometimes publications in front on the topic of the day, or on subculture. It seems to close 30 minutes later than department stores in Ikebukuro. The publications on animation or comics are sold in another store.

Going further to Kanamecho station of the Eidan subway Yurakucho line through the street which comes down from Ikebukuro station, there is the Kanamecho Branch of Musashi Shoten. It is convenient for night birds that it is open till very late at night --- it may be open till 2 or 3 a.m. or later. I think it hopes for Rikkyo College students.
